Scent profile: Fresh lemongrass lifted by crisp lemon and a subtle rosemary note — bright, clean, and naturally energizing. Cymbopogon flexuosus (lemongrass) oil leads, with citrus limon (lemon) oil and rosmarinus officinalis (rosemary) leaf oil supporting. Pure essential oils only — no synthetic fragrance compounds, no phthalates, no dyes.
Why sulfate-free for daily use: Most hand soaps that produce a satisfying lather use sodium lauryl or laureth sulfate. They clean, but wash repeatedly through the day and you'll notice the toll on your skin. We built this around plant-derived cleansers and added aloe vera and vitamin E to make it comfortable whether you're washing twice a day or ten times.
